In South America, there’s a mysterious monument that runs virtually a mile (1.5 kilometers) by way of the Andes Mountains in southern Peru. Monte Sierpe, that means Mountain of the Serpent, is made up of roughly 5,200 holes organized in a row. Researchers are proposing new theories about what they have been.

In a examine revealed immediately within the journal ancienta global staff of researchers carried out sediment evaluation and took drone pictures of Montesierpe. Their outcomes counsel that the monument, also called the “Band of Halls,” was utilized by indigenous peoples for accounting and commerce.

“Hypotheses concerning the aim of Monte Sierpe vary from protection, storage and interpretation to water harvesting, fog trapping and horticulture,” Jacob Bongers, an archaeologist on the College of Sydney and lead writer of the examine, mentioned in a press release within the journal Antiquities. “The performance of this website stays unclear.”

The outlet is split into sections, every 3.3 to six.6 ft (1 to 2 meters) huge and 1.6 to three.3 ft (0.5 to 1 meter) deep. By conducting microbiological analyzes of the pit deposits and taking high-resolution aerial pictures, the analysis staff make clear this complicated monument at each the micro and macro ranges. Microbiological evaluation revealed plant stays reminiscent of corn, in addition to wild vegetation historically used for basket making.

“These information assist the speculation that in pre-Hispanic occasions, native teams usually lined pits with plant materials, loaded items into them, and used woven baskets and bundles for transportation,” Bongers defined.

Moreover, aerial pictures counsel that the outlet association is in line with the numerical sample. Researchers argue that this, together with its fragmented group, makes Monte Sierpe akin to a large quipu, a system of recording strings and knots utilized by Andean peoples. Subsequently, Monte Sierpe could have been a big accounting system utilized by the Inca state to gather tribute.

The Incas have been a pre-Columbian indigenous civilization finest recognized for the development of Machu Picchu (additionally celebrated nowadays for its triple-walled construction). descendants They’re the Quechua-speaking individuals of the Andes. Monte Sierpe was situated between two Incan administrative areas and was most likely situated close to a pre-Hispanic highway intersection. Moreover, this space is situated between the highlands and the lowland coastal plains, and can be the realm the place communities from each areas would have gathered for commerce.

In abstract, the researchers suggest that the pre-Incan kingdom of Chincha initially developed and used Monte Sierpe for managed commerce, which was later remodeled into an Incan house for accounting.

“This analysis contributes to an essential Andean case examine of how previous communities modified previous landscapes to carry individuals collectively and facilitate interplay,” Bongers concluded. “Our findings broaden our understanding of the origins and variety of barter markets and indigenous accounting practices inside and past the traditional Andes.”
